Handover note — Crumbwheel order cutoffs.

Welcome aboard. The bakery cutoff rule in Crumbwheel closes same-day orders at 14:00 local to each storefront, not UTC — this has bitten us twice. Holiday overrides live in the calendar service and take precedence silently, so always check there first when a cutoff looks wrong. To unlock the calendar service's admin console after a restart, enter the recovery passphrase below.

vault phrase of bagap-bahaf = silion-pelox-sorox-casdor-quenwyn-fraax-eliox-praael-kelion-quenvan-kasox-rusael-norius-belvan

Ticket: Staging env misconfigured for Siftgate bloom filter

The bloom layer in front of the Pellet KV store is rejecting all lookups in staging because the env file was copied from the dev template without credentials. False-positive tuning values are fine; only the auth line is missing. To unblock the weekly demo, the Pellet admission secret must be set on the following line.

env line for yaguf-fajop: LEDGER_TOKEN13=fb08984397349

- [ ] Step 7: Archive cold storage buckets (Glacierline tier). Confirm both ceremony witnesses are present, verify bucket manifests match the Oxbow ledger, then seal the archive key shares. Plugin authors may observe but not handle shares. Once sealed, the archive index itself is encrypted and can only be reopened with the passphrase below.

vault phrase of badup-hahig = tamael-aldael-kelmir-istael-fenok-istwyn-tamius-jorath-oliion

Subject: Heads up — DR drill and canary gating

Hi plugin folks,

Quick note before next week's disaster-recovery drill: GateKite's canary gating rules will be in strict mode, so plugins that fail the error-budget check get held at 5% automatically. Nothing you need to change — just don't panic if rollouts stall Tuesday. If your plugin's gating config gets wiped during the drill, restore it from the sealed backup using the passphrase below.

vault phrase of hahop-badug = novvan-ulaion-zorius-noviel-gorwyn-casix-tamys